    Typical Configurations for Education

    The P600 system is inherently flexible, allowing schools to design a layout that matches their specific site footprint and teaching requirements. Each module is approximately 13m², and they can be combined in various ways:

    • Single Module (13m²): Ideal as a 1:1 intervention room, a SEN breakout space, or a small administrative office.
    • Double Module (26m²): Suitable for a nursery group room, a small specialized classroom, or a staff room.
    • Four to Six Modules (52m² - 78m²): The standard footprint for a full-sized primary or secondary classroom, including space for storage and accessibility requirements.
    • Complexes (8+ Modules): These larger builds can create entire departmental blocks, including corridors, multiple classrooms, and integrated WCs.

    What is Included as Standard

    Every building we deliver to Peterborough is built to a high internal finish, ensuring it feels like a permanent part of the school estate. The standard specification includes:

    • Fully insulated steel-framed walls, floor, and roof.
    • Plastered and painted internal walls (no plastic-coated panels).
    • Durable laminate flooring suitable for high footfall.
    • LED lighting and ample double sockets.
    • Double-glazed uPVC windows and secure external doors.
    • Exterior cladding in a range of colours, which can be selected to match existing school buildings.

    Optional extras frequently requested by educational clients include internal WC and shower compartments, kitchenettes for staff rooms, air conditioning for climate control, and external decking or ramps for DDA compliance.

    Indicative Pricing for Peterborough Projects

    Pricing for modular classrooms varies based on the number of modules, the complexity of the internal layout, and the chosen optional extras. For educational projects in the East of England, indicative price bands are typically:

    • Small intervention rooms: £30,000 – £45,000.
    • Standard single classrooms: £45,000 – £65,000.
    • Large multi-module blocks: £70,000 – £90,000+.

    Planning Permission in Cambridgeshire

    While modular buildings are faster to install, they are still subject to planning regulations. Whether a classroom requires full planning permission or falls under permitted development depends on the size of the unit, its height, and how long it is intended to remain on site. We recommend that all Peterborough clients consult with the Peterborough City Council planning department or their relevant local authority early in the process. Similarly, while our units are built to high thermal standards, specific Building Regulations compliance is a project-specific matter that should be verified by your building control officer.
